为网站首页添加一个“key-value”传送门功能
所谓key value,就比如输入“msds”,然后点击“冲鸭”按钮,就可以跳转到对应的页面:http://www.bossqiao.com/program_info/ds_info.php
msds是key,value是对应的网址
可以跳转到任意网址,不限于自己的网站,比如输入“猫”,跳转到b站上的“岩合光昭的猫步走世界”:https://www.bilibili.com/video/av1297817/
该功能的适用范围?
相当于一个浏览器书签功能,当收藏的网页多了之后,找起来很不方便。而且很多网页可能很久才浏览一次,都添加到书签里会显得臃肿,这时候如果记住关键字,就能比较方便的访问。
具体实现:
把key-value存储到go_menu.txt文件中:
index.php文件中读取go_menu.txt,将key-value存储到数组$go_menu中
这里使用的是associate数组,方便用key-value读取数据
对应的html以及js代码
下面这行代码实现php数组转js变量(对象)
var link_list = <?php echo json_encode($go_menu)?>;
访问网页时,先运行服务器端的php代码,然后再运行客户端的js代码
【2019-02-10更新】
添加按下回车键事件
【2019-02-18更新】
实际演示可以访问蟹老板的主页:http://www.bossqiao.com/